WebMay 8, 2024 · Function. The primary function of RNA is to create proteins via translation. RNA carries genetic information that is translated by ribosomes into various proteins necessary for cellular processes. mRNA, rRNA, and tRNA are the three main types of RNA involved in protein synthesis. WebJul 4, 2024 · Functions. mRNA (messenger RNA) Acts as a template for protein synthesis. tRNA (transfer RNA) Transports amino acids to the ribosome. rRNA (ribosomal RNA) Assembles mRNA, tRNA, and translation factors for peptide bond formation. miRNA (micro RNA) Antisense RNA involved in gene regulation.
